How to play Changes on ukulele
Try the everywhere 4/4 as a starting point: d – d u – u d –. This arrangement is in Gb major. This one leans on trickier shapes, with the chords at the proficient level. Prefer easier shapes? Transpose the song down 1 half-step, then a capo on fret 1 brings you back to the key on this page.
4 ukulele chords used in "Changes" by Hayd: B, Db, Ebm and Gb
